- Description
- This requirement is for repairing body damage and to perform necessary mechanical and body repairs on a 2011 MCI Coach J4500 Bus (Tag number G32-0403K, VIN# 2MG3JMHA7BW065734). The damage is due to Traffic Accident. Description of work includes repair of all body damage to the right side, frame, lights, right rear drive axle and suspension. The requirement is to repair this unit complete for return to service. All equipment must be covered by the manufacturer's warranty. All items shall include standard warranty. Repairs will be completed in accordance with industry standards. Vendors shall be in compliance with all EPA and OSHA standards and requirements. MSDS and any other required documents must be on site. Vendors must be properly insured to cover any losses for GSA vehicles that are in their shop. Valid business license(s) is required in accordance with state and local guidelines. All employees of selected vendor must be paid in accordance with local Department of Labor established wages.
